An Overview of Muslim Immigrants and Refugees
Originating from over 100 places, immigrant Muslims in the us is ethnically and linguistically different. As per the community Almanac (the entire world Almanac and e-book of Basic facts 2006, 2006; Nasr, 2005) roughly 4,657,000 Muslims live in the usa. The best quantities of immigrants be caused by three main places: Southern Asia, Iran, plus the Arabic-speaking countries. The only biggest gang of Muslim immigrants was inspired by to the south Asia (Bangladesh, Indian, and Pakistan). Next largest groups include things like around 300,000 Iranians and 600,000 Muslims from Arab region.
Regarding these excellent, Muslims become an incredibly diverse crowd whose geographical source and attitude is not inferred only on such basis as institution. In addition, individuals shouldn’t be believed being Muslim based upon geographic source, many Muslim-majority places need considerable amount of people of additional faiths which may however promote numerous educational traditions using their Muslim friends. Faith, geographical origins, and heritage therefore is different organizations; one cannot simply getting presumed while using many.
Because Muslims vary a great deal, it is important, as a first action to learning their demands and problem, in order to comprehend the particular places they arrive from and so the many educational knowledge the two put.
